Job description

Thames Valley Family Health Team (TVFHT) is one of the largest and most comprehensive family health teams in Ontario, serving patients across more than 15 sites in four counties. Our mission is to provide collaborative, patient-centered care through an interprofessional team approach that emphasizes innovation, access, equity, and excellence.

We are currently seeking an Administrative Assistant who thrives in a dynamic, multi-site healthcare environment to provide crucial administrative support to senior leadership and clinical teams. This position will support the operations of TVFHT, with direct executive administrative support provided to the Executive Director of Clinical Services, Director of Quality and Transformation, and the Interprofessional Clinical Leads (ICLs).

This position involves managing executive team calendars, coordinating meetings and events, preparing documents, tracking projects, and providing committee and operational support across the organization. The ideal candidate is highly organized, professional, and capable of managing multiple priorities with discretion and independence.

Requirements
  • Post‑secondary education in Office Administration, Healthcare Administration, or related discipline.
  • 3–5 years of experience in a similar administrative or executive support role, preferably in healthcare.
  • High pro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) and Microsoft Teams.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ills (verbal and written).
  • Excellent time‑management, organizational, and multitasking skills.
  • Proven 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• A valid driver’s license and access to a vehicle is required (some travel may be required between sites).
  • This position is on site at our support office.
Skills/Abilities
  • Provide executive administrative support including calendar management, meeting preparation, and correspondence handling for Executive Director of Clinical Services, Director of Quality and Transformation, and Interprofessional Clinical Leads.
  • Coordinate team and Health and Safety committee meetings, including agenda preparation, minute‑taking, and follow‑up on action items from the above.
  • Prepare and format documents, reports, presentations, and communication materials.
  • Support onboarding logistics as needed and provide support throughout the student placement process.
  • Maintain internal tracking documents, contact lists, and distribution channels.
  • Assist with internal communication, project coordination, and administrative planning tasks.
  • Act as liaison between clinical teams, leadership, and external stakeholders.
  • Ensure confidentiality and professional communication is upheld at all times.
